摘要
The structure of four new palladium complexes [Pd(HL2)Cl2 and Pd(L1–3)2] with 3-(2-pyridyl)-5-R-1,2,4-triazoles (R=H, CH3, Ph respectively HL1, HL2, HL3) was proposed based on IR, NMR, UV spectroscopy and MALDI mass spectrometry data analysis. It is found that the complexation of HL2 and HL3 with Pd2+ ions results in a decrease of their fluorescence intensity and it is vice versa in case of HL1. Furthermore, the influence of the substituent (R) in the 3-(2-pirydyl)-5-R-1,2,4-triazoles on the fluorescent and protolytic properties of HL1–3 was investigated.
